database muziek

emou

Gebruiker
Lid geworden
29 aug 2017
Berichten
27
Hallo,

ik heb met behulp van AI een bestand gemaakt in Access dat verbonden is met een bestand in verkenner waar ik liedjes opsla.
het pad in verkenner is "N:\mijn_muziek".

de bedoeling is dat de lijst in access correspondeert met mijn verkenner en als ik een nieuw liedje heb ik dat dan ook kan zien in mijn access bestand en met de knop die ik geïnstalleerd heb dat muziekje kan afspelen.

Maar het access bestand toont bijna dubbel zoveel liedjes dan in mijn verkenner

wat is er fout met mijn bestand, AI kan mij blijkbaar niet helpen
 

Bijlagen

Er wordt nergens gecontroleerd of een liedje dat in N:\mijn_muziek staat al aanwezig is in je database. Dus iedere keer dat je de import start worden alle aanwezig liedjes nog eens toegevoegd. Sommige staan er al 6 keer in, zoals bijvoorbeeld "Als De Dag Van Toen".
 
Laatst bewerkt:
Er wordt nergens gecontroleerd of een liedje dat in N:\mijn_muziek staat al aanwezig is in je database.
Zo te zien wordt er wel enig controle uitgevoerd, en wel op de bestandsnaam:
Code:
If DCount("*", "tblMuziek", "Bestandsnaam = '" & Replace(file.Name, "'", "''") & "'") = 0 Then
Hoewel ik het gegoochel met de enkele aanhalingstekens niet begrijp (en het daar mis op kan gaan) lijkt dit wel te werken.
Dat er desondanks dubbele bestandsnamen voorkomen is mogelijk een gevolg van een verwerking zonder die controle.
Bij de aangehaalde titel speelt (ook) iets anders. Die komt inderdaad 6 keer voor, maar dan wel in 4 verschillende bestandsnamen die 1 of 2 keer voorkomen. Gevolg van al dan niet een spatie voor de uitvoerende.
Als De Dag Van Toen_ Mama's Jasje .mp3 2
Als De Dag Van Toen_ Reinhard Mey .mp3 2
Als De Dag Van Toen_Mama's Jasje .mp3 1
Als De Dag Van Toen_Reinhard Mey .mp3 1


Bij dit als kan men zich afvragen waarom je zoiets in Access (of Excel) zou willen bouwen.
 
Laatst bewerkt:
Terug
Bovenaan Onderaan